The MAX4864L/MAX4865L/MAX4866L/MAX4867 over-
voltage protection controllers protect low-voltage sys-
tems against high-voltage faults up to +28V, and
negative voltages down to -28V. These devices drive a
low-cost complementary MOSFET. If the input voltage
exceeds the overvoltage threshold, these devices turn
off the n-channel MOSFET to prevent damage to the
protected components. If the input voltage drops below
ground, the devices turn off the p-channel MOSFET to
prevent damage to the protected components. An inter-
nal charge pump eliminates the need for external
capacitors and drives the MOSFET GATEN for a simple,
robust solution.
The overvoltage thresholds are preset to +7.4V
(MAX4864L), +6.35V (MAX4865L), +5.8V (MAX4866L),
and +4.65V (MAX4867). When the input voltage drops
below the undervoltage lockout (UVLO) threshold, the
devices enter a low-current standby mode (8.5µA). Also in
shutdown (EN set to logic-high), the current is reduced fur-
ther (0.4µA). The MAX4864L/MAX4865L/MAX4866L have
a +2.85V UVLO threshold, and the MAX4867 has a +2.5V
UVLO threshold.
In addition, a ±15kV ESD protection is provided to the
input when bypassed with a 1µF capacitor to ground. All
devices are offered in a small 6-pin SOT23 and a 6-pin,
2mm x 2mm µDFN package, and are specified for
operation over the -40°C to +85°C temperature range.
